# Contributors

From this section, you can manage all the members in your Typo account. You can edit their email or mark them as active or inactive. Once you mark any member as inactive, the data for that member will not be calculated while generating insights.

### Sync Members

Use this button to sync your members with the Git account. All the newly added members will be marked as inactive in Typo, you can mark them as active from this section.
